Output 623abda0730f1cc6a4881b4346d60d4be18f848bb427ea98eaceb4b6a65d6c25:0

value
14980000
script pubkey
OP_0 OP_PUSHBYTES_20 876b98ecbca0a58d68364e9f26843fc6fdf72fc2
address
ltc1qsa4e3m9u5zjc66pkf60jdpplcm7lwt7z0jdtrg
transaction
623abda0730f1cc6a4881b4346d60d4be18f848bb427ea98eaceb4b6a65d6c25
spent
true